Team ConnectionsBrian Scalabrine played for the Nets from 2001-05
Josh Boone and Ray Allen are former UConn Huskie
Eddie House played for the Nets during the 2006-07 season
Assistant Coaches Doug Overton (1999-2001) and Roy Rogers (1997-98) both played for the Celtics
Eddie House and Keyon Dooling were teammates with the Clippers during the 2003-04 season
Tony Battie played for the Celtics from1998-2004
Trenton Hassell and Kevin Garnett were teammates in Minnesota from 2003-07
Marquis Daniels and Devin Harris were teammates in Dallas from 2004-06
Jarvis Hayes and Rasheed Wallace were teammates in Detroit
during the 2007-08 season
Eduardo Najera and Marquis Daniels were teammates in Dallas during the 2003-04 season.
Game Notes Celtics swept the season series 4-0 against New Jersey in 2008-09
Paul Pierce led the Celtics with 19.0 points per game last season
Devin Harris averaged 16.3 points per game against the Celtics last season in four games
The Celtics are currently on a nine game winning streak against the Nets which marks their longest winning streak against the Nets since an 11
game winning streak that spanned the 1980-81 and 1981-82 season
The Celtics are leading the all-time series 103-54 with the Celtics 55-24 at home
The Nets are traditional rivals of the Celtics as we think back to the 2002 Eastern Conference Finals where the Nets defeated the Celtics in a hotly contested 6 game series. The Nets have fallen on hard times and this season are just marking time until they can make a play for LeBron or some other big free agent in 2010. Their ownership and even location are up in the air at this point and that can't make for a very stable club.
Both teams are playing in the second of back to back games and both teams had to travel the night before. New Jersey played at Philly and
Boston played the Suns at home. However, older legs have a harder time in back to back games. If the Wolves game was any indication, this may be closer than it should be.
The Nets are still winless after a 3 point loss to Philly on Friday. The Celtics are no longer undefeated so now they can get on with the rest of the season. For the second game in a row, the Celtics allowed a team to shoot over 50%. The winless Nets are an ideal team to get them back on track.
